Pinnacle Ridge is supported starting with AGESA PinnaclePI 1.0.0.1 or even 1.0.0.0 (not that widespread), 1.0.0.2a is just optimized code for Raven Ridge GPU/CPU power management and a few memory optimisations.
Raven Ridge has support starting with AGESA RavenPI 1.0.7.0 (Old code based on SummitPI) and PinnacleRidge with AGESA PinnaclePI 1.0.0.0 (full re-write of the AGESA, not based on old Branch of SummitPI, Raven Ridge being a 2nd gen CPU was also merge into PinnaclePI AGESA) PS: ASRock never used the AGESA RavenPI code, they jumped from SummitPI straight to PinnaclePI Cheers No changes are expected for Summit Ridge and Pinnacle Ridge CPU in AGESA 1.0.0.2, they target Raven Ridge bugs On the matter, Raven Ridge is unusable in gaming or apps which load both CPU and GPU at the same time, should have released UEFI with 1.0.0.2a even with minor bugs than no release at all, it cant get any worse than current 1.0.0.1a UEFI's (or can it?)
